Effects of Self-esteem, Parenting Attitude, & Social Support on Adolescents' Coping Strategies

The purpose of this study is to explore the effects of self-esteem, parenting attitude, and social support on adolescents' coping strategies. The subjects of the study were 545 middle- and high school-aged adolescents in Cheongju and Goesan areas. The main findings were as follows: First, the results of hierarchical regression analysis showed that school level, self-esteem, democratic parenting attitude, and school support were statistically significant in explaining positive coping strategies. Self-esteem and school support have the greatest effect. Second, within-the-family coping strategies were influenced by democratic parenting attitude, school support. Democratic parenting attitude has the most significant effect. Third, self-esteem, school support, and community support were found to be the variables that explained outside-the-family coping strategies. Community support has the biggest effect. The results of this study indicate that there is an urgent need to establish a supportive system which helps school-aged adolescents' better adjustment and positive coping. In particular, by reflecting their cultural context in which face-to-face interaction is lacking, it is necessary to provide a proper space for personal interactions and communication with school human resources. As social support turned out important in adolescents' coping, we need to build up a safety net to supplement insufficient family resources through school and community, such as programs that strengthen the role of religious institutions as well as social welfare organizations and counseling agencies.
